Instant Pot Hard Boiled Eggs

Making hard boiled eggs in the Instant Pot saves time and they turn out perfectly every time.

Ingredients
 

  • 1 dozen fresh eggs less or more is fine
  • 1 cup water

Instructions
 

  • Put the trivet in the Instant Pot liner. Pour in the water.
  • Set the eggs on the trivet in a single layer. Overlapping or stacking can lead to cracked eggs.
  • Lock the lid and set the vent to sealing. Press the pressure cook button and set the time to 9 minutes. When the time is up, manually release the pressure right away.
  • Set the eggs in a bowl of cold water to cool for 5 minutes. Transfer to the refrigerator if not using right away, or peel and eat.

Notes

  • You can cook as many or as few eggs as you like. I've even cooked only 1 egg.
  • For a soft, slightly runny yolk, cook for only 3 minutes.
  • Stack the eggs might cause them to crack, but it usually doesn't negatively affect the outcome.
  • You can put the eggs in an ice bath to cool them quicker, but I find that leads to a very difficult to peel egg. Let it cool naturally or in cold water.
